MORPHETT, Norman Alexander

Service Number: 1955
Enlisted: 20 May 1915, Keswick, South Australia
Last Rank: Corporal
Last Unit: 27th Infantry Battalion
Born: Hyde Park, South Australia, 28 September 1893
Home Town: Adelaide, South Australia
Schooling: Not yet discovered
Occupation: Clerk
Died: Adelaide, South Australia, 1 December 1958, aged 65 years, cause of death not yet discovered
Cemetery: AIF Cemetery, West Terrace Cemetery, Adelaide, South Australia
Section: KO, Road: 7A, Site No: 23
Memorials: Unley Town Hall WW1 Honour Board, Unley Wayville Honor Roll
